The Opportunity

The Sr Embedded Software Engineer works out of our San Diego, CA location in the Infectious Diseases Group in Abbott Rapid Diagnostics. We’re empowering smarter medical and economic decision-making to help transform the way people manage their health at all stages of life. Every day, more than 10 million tests are run on Abbott’s diagnostics instruments, providing lab results for millions of people.

This role oversees the design, development, and validation of software for embedded systems, ensuring compliance with FDA requirements. They play a crucial role in software design, coding, and validation, addressing moderate scope problems, and participating in software development activities under guidance and mentoring junior engineers. Adherence to FDA-compliant Design Control procedures and proficiency in software implementation are key aspects of the role.
